Solution for p+39=2p equation:


Simplifying
p + 39 = 2p

Reorder the terms:
39 + p = 2p

Solving
39 + p = 2p

Solving for variable 'p'.

Move all terms containing p to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-2p' to each side of the equation.
39 + p + -2p = 2p + -2p

Combine like terms: p + -2p = -1p
39 + -1p = 2p + -2p

Combine like terms: 2p + -2p = 0
39 + -1p = 0

Add '-39' to each side of the equation.
39 + -39 + -1p = 0 + -39

Combine like terms: 39 + -39 = 0
0 + -1p = 0 + -39
-1p = 0 + -39

Combine like terms: 0 + -39 = -39
-1p = -39

Divide each side by '-1'.
p = 39

Simplifying
p = 39
